1 write to _parent
Microsoft.ML.Transforms (1)
MissingValueDroppingTransformer.cs (1)
187_parent = parent;
12 references to _parent
Microsoft.ML.Transforms (12)
MissingValueDroppingTransformer.cs (12)
188_types = new DataViewType[_parent.ColumnPairs.Length]; 189_srcTypes = new DataViewType[_parent.ColumnPairs.Length]; 190_srcCols = new int[_parent.ColumnPairs.Length]; 191_isNAs = new Delegate[_parent.ColumnPairs.Length]; 192for (int i = 0; i < _parent.ColumnPairs.Length; i++) 194inputSchema.TryGetColumnIndex(_parent.ColumnPairs[i].inputColumnName, out _srcCols[i]); 197throw _parent.Host.Except($"Column '{srcCol.Name}' is not a vector column"); 199throw _parent.Host.Except($"Column '{srcCol.Name}' is of type {srcCol.Type.GetItemType()}, which does not support missing values"); 207var result = new DataViewSchema.DetachedColumn[_parent.ColumnPairs.Length]; 208for (int i = 0; i < _parent.ColumnPairs.Length; i++) 212result[i] = new DataViewSchema.DetachedColumn(_parent.ColumnPairs[i].outputColumnName, _types[i], builder.ToAnnotations()); 220Contracts.Assert(0 <= iinfo && iinfo < _parent.ColumnPairs.Length);